Why is Shinto Paint Co., Ltd. ?
1
Weak Long Term Fundamental Strength with an average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) of 0.35%
- Poor long term growth as Net Sales has grown by an annual rate of -1.63% and Operating profit at -17.27% over the last 5 years
- Company's ability to service its debt is weak with a poor EBIT to Interest (avg) ratio of -23.18
2
Flat results in Jun 25
- INTEREST(HY) At JPY 37 MM has Grown at 42.31%
- PRE-TAX PROFIT(Q) At JPY 84 MM has Fallen at -64.26%
- NET PROFIT(Q) At JPY -6 MM has Fallen at -103.47%
3
Risky -
- The stock is trading risky as compared to its average historical valuations
- Over the past year, while the stock has generated a return of -5.34%, its profits have risen by 156.9% ; the PEG ratio of the company is 0.1
- At the current price, the company has a high dividend yield of 0.8
4
Consistent Underperformance against the benchmark over the last 3 years
- Along with generating -5.34% returns in the last 1 year, the stock has also underperformed Japan Nikkei 225 in each of the last 3 annual periods
